Facebook Music Rocks! Move over MySpace. Facebook is jamming to the core of your audience and DNA. Facebook Pages for musicians have existed since pages went live. But what is new is the main music page that shows a lot of the features that are available on facebook pages for music artists.
What I find interesting is that facebook is making a solid play at the core of MySpace; which is music. While it is still a bit utilitarian looking by myspace standards; I like it. I can listen to songs from the artisits, a discography catalog of all of their album/CD releases, watch videos, see photos, upload fan photos, become a fan, etc. This is cool stuff.
Only a matter of time before ticketmaster or ticketsnow becomes the gateway to purchase tickets to shows right through facebook. I can envision picking out my seats live and buying them instantly.
Image how bands and music promoters could run contests on these pages and encourage participation with rewards like VIP passes, etc. I can also see a day (tomorrow or very soon) where apps could actually become part of the consumption/participation model in conjunction with these pages.
I can also envision ways that these pages could have apps embedded and they could find interesting ways to reward & communicate with fans with video blasts, messages, etc. I could also imagine fans being able to have pre-release videos sent right to their cell phones/email.
